Leah broke her right tib/fib skydiving in Byron last Sunday on the sunset load. I wasn't there, but what I gathered is that she landed in a ditch or birm that she didn't see until it was too late and was landing off to the side of the LZ. She was also going slightly downwind with light and variable winds, and didn't have a great flare.

She had a slightly compound open fracture of the tibia near her ankle that was bleeding. No bone was externally visible and the hole in the skin is small. She was in the hospital for a few days and had surgery to install a titanium rod inside her tibia and a few screws.

She's now at her parents house in the bay area recovering. I've been visiting her as much as I can. She's in pain and feeling a little weak. Her leg should take around 4 months to recover. She'll be on the computer. I attached some pics, the first one was taken by Harry.
